Saiful Bouquet provided structural engineering for the 10,600 sq. foot wood/steel frame private luxury passenger terminal. NetJets, the world leader in fractional aircraft ownership and private flight services, opened this private airport terminal in Los Angeles, which has been one of the company’s highest traffic regions. The facility includes a conference room, a playroom for the kids, kitchen and pilot’s lounge and operations center. The main building relies on plywood shear walls for lateral bracing, with steel moment frames at the open lobby area. Steel HSS sections were used to create the cantilevered canopy to mimic wings of the airplanes.

The facility offers easy access to Santa Monica, Malibu, and Hollywood while avoiding the congestion of the Los Angeles International Airport.
